Topic Affinity Analysis for an Astronomy and Astrophysics Data Set

In this paper we map the affinity between topics extracted from a body of literature published in Astronomy and Astrophysics journals between 2003-2010. The topics are extracted using the popular information theoretic Infomap clustering algorithm (Rosvall & Bergstrom, 2008) iteratively on the giant component of the direct citation network constructed from the data. The affinity network shows what topics are disproportionally well connected (by citations) to other topics. The topology of the network highlights a large division into astrophysics versus astronomically oriented publications. Bridging between those two domains is a population of smaller topics. Going forward, we plan to create and analyze topic affinity network maps for alternative solutions to the topic extraction challenge on that same data set that are produced by our colleagues and that will be discussed and compared at the proposed special session on 'Same data? Different results? The performative nature of algorithms for topic detection in science' at ISSI 2015. We expect that topic affinity mappings will help to examine the nature of differences between different topic extraction solutions. Conference Topic Methods and techniques (special session on algorithms for topic detection) Introduction The mapping of research topics and collaborative ties in scientific research fields (Morris 2008) is flourishing for a number of reasons. Increasingly, scholarly publications and their metadata are available from a variety of sources (digital libraries, institutional and disciplinary repositories, along with bibliographic abstracting services such as the long established Web of Knowledge and more recently, Scopus). Complementing this is the emergence of sophisticated algorithms for the analysis of complex networks (Newman 2003b) and the wide availability of advanced user-friendly network analysis and visualization tools like pajek, gephi, or VOS Viewer. However, many different algorithms for community extraction and topic detection exist and offer different suggestions what the most prominent groupings of publications or authors may be. The special session at ISSI 2015 sets out to systematically compare and evaluate the origin, extent, and implication of differences between topic extraction methods. In this paper we describe the results of our approach to topic detection and topic affinity analysis to the shared 'astronomy and astrophysics' data set. This approach has emerged from research program on studying behavioral patterns in scientific communities and comparing them across fields, and may help to shed light on the nature of differences between topic extraction solutions. Background As described in (Velden 2009), we take a mixed method approach to studying field-specific practices and cultures of scientific communities, integrating ethnographic field studies with network analytic methods. The network analytic method we apply here to the 'astronomy and astrophysics' data set is part of an ongoing effort to combine network analytic with ethnographic methods (Velden, Haque & Lagoze, 2010; Velden, 2013). This evolves a tradition of close-up analysis of scientific networks and communication practices started by Crane's work (1972) on invisible colleges and taken up more recently by Zuccala (2006).
